The Early Days of Robotic Vacuum Cleaners
The idea of a robotic vacuum cleaner dates back to the 1990s, however the very first commercially effective design was introduced by iRobot in 2002 with the Roomba. At first, these devices were viewed as a luxury item, primarily utilized by tech lovers and early adopters. Over the years, developments in technology have made robotic vacuum more accessible, budget friendly, and feature-rich. Today, they are a typical sight in families across the world, assisting millions of people keep a clean living environment with minimal effort.
How Robotic Vacuum Cleaners Work
Robotic vacuum are equipped with a variety of sensors and advanced algorithms to browse and clean up a home successfully. Here's a breakdown of the crucial components and innovations:
Sensors: These include infrared, ultrasonic, and optical sensing units that help the robot identify challenges, prevent falls, and map the environment.Navigation Systems: Modern designs use SLAM (Simultaneous Localization and Mapping) innovation to develop a detailed map of the home and prepare the most effective cleaning path.Cleaning Mechanisms: Most robotic vacuums have brushes, vacuum motors, and filters to choose up dirt, dust, and particles. Some designs also consist of mopping capabilities.Connectivity: Many robotic vacuums can be controlled through mobile phones and incorporated with home automation systems like Amazon Alexa and Google Assistant.Battery Life: Most designs have a battery that lasts in between 60 to 120 minutes, and they can go back to their charging dock when the battery is low.Secret Features and Benefits

As technology continues to develop, so do robotic vacuum cleaners. Here are a few of the current advancements:
AI and Machine Learning: Modern robotic vacuums utilize AI to learn and adjust to the user's cleaning routines and choices, making them more user-friendly and reliable.Boosted Navigation: Advanced navigation systems, consisting of LiDAR (Light Detection and Ranging), offer even more precise mapping and challenge avoidance.Improved Cleaning Power: Newer designs have more powerful motors and advanced cleaning methods, such as oscillating brushes and specialized cleaning modes for various surface areas.Battery Life and Charging: Batteries have become more efficient, enabling longer cleaning sessions. Some models even include fast charging and wireless charging capabilities.Noise Reduction: Many manufacturers have actually focused on decreasing the sound level of their robotic vacuums, making them less disruptive throughout use.Environmental Impact

Frequently asked questions
Q: How do I set up a robotic vacuum cleaner?
A: Setting up a robotic vacuum cleaner is generally straightforward. Most designs feature a user handbook and setup wizard. Typically, you need to:Charge the battery completely.Place the charging dock in an ideal location.Set up any required filters or brushes.Connect the vacuum to your Wi-Fi network (if appropriate).Set up cleaning schedules and preferences through the app.
Q: Can a robotic vacuum tidy stairs?
A: Most robotic vacuum are not created to clean stairs. They are equipped with sensors to find and prevent stairs to prevent falls. However, some models have a "stair-climbing" function, however it is restricted and not as efficient as cleaning flat surfaces.
Q: How often should I clean the brushes and filters?
A: It is advised to clean up the brushes and filters after every 5-10 cleaning sessions, depending upon the frequency of usage and the amount of hair and particles in your home. Routine cleaning ensures optimum performance and avoids blocking.
Q: Are robotic vacuum suitable for homes with family pets?
A: Yes, lots of robotic vacuum cleaners are specifically created to manage pet hair and dander. They have powerful suction, specialized brushes, and advanced filtering systems to keep your home clean and fresh.
Q: Can a robotic vacuum cleaner replace a conventional vacuum?
A: While robotic vacuum cleaners are highly reliable for everyday maintenance cleaning, they may not totally change standard vacuum. For deep cleaning or particular tasks, such as cleaning carpets, a conventional vacuum may still be required.Tips for Choosing the Right Robotic Vacuum Cleaner
